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6275436195 487992 1814 86877
629515 187
629515 187
532112 879651 643101
All about undefined
Interested in learning more?
629515 187
532112 879651 643101
See more
2388848934 71807972349
3699144491 35513554760 4908
See more
225 50792
98594075 172 1983056 7481209053
See more